البرمجة

تخصيص صفحة تسجيل دخول ووردبريس

كيف تخصص صفحة تسجيل الدخول لووردبريس بسهولة

تُعدّ صفحة تسجيل الدخول في ووردبريس من العناصر الأساسية التي يتفاعل معها المستخدمون أو مديرو المواقع بشكل متكرر، خصوصًا في المواقع التي تتطلب تسجيل دخول للزوار أو الكتاب أو المسؤولين. إلا أن المظهر الافتراضي لهذه الصفحة قد لا يعكس هوية الموقع أو علامته التجارية، وقد يعطي انطباعًا تقنيًا جافًا، لا يتماشى مع تجربة المستخدم المطلوبة في المواقع الحديثة.

تخصيص صفحة تسجيل الدخول لووردبريس لا يعني فقط تغيير الشعار، بل يمكن أن يمتد ليشمل الألوان والخطوط والخلفيات وحتى الرسائل المخصصة وخيارات الوصول، وهو أمر يساهم في تعزيز الاحترافية وحماية الهوية البصرية للموقع. في هذا المقال المطول، سيتم التطرق إلى أهم الطرق والوسائل التي تتيح تخصيص صفحة تسجيل الدخول في ووردبريس بسهولة، مع التركيز على الجوانب العملية والتقنية التي يمكن تنفيذها دون الحاجة إلى مهارات برمجية متقدمة.


أهمية تخصيص صفحة تسجيل الدخول

قبل الدخول في تفاصيل التنفيذ، من المفيد فهم الأسباب التي تجعل من تخصيص صفحة تسجيل الدخول خطوة أساسية في إدارة أي موقع ووردبريس:

  • تعزيز العلامة التجارية: بتعديل الشعار والألوان والخلفيات يمكن خلق تجربة متسقة مع هوية الموقع.

  • تحسين تجربة المستخدم: واجهة تسجيل جذابة وبسيطة تسهل على المستخدمين الدخول والتنقل.

  • زيادة الأمان: عبر إزالة بعض العناصر الافتراضية التي قد يستغلها المتطفلون، مثل رابط “نسيت كلمة المرور” أو تلميحات حول اسم المستخدم.

  • إضافة وظائف مخصصة: مثل تسجيل الدخول عبر الشبكات الاجتماعية، أو تفعيل المصادقة الثنائية، أو تخصيص رسائل الخطأ.


الطرق المتاحة لتخصيص صفحة تسجيل الدخول

1. التخصيص عبر الإضافات (Plugins)

يُعتبر استخدام الإضافات من أسهل الطرق لتخصيص صفحة تسجيل الدخول، حيث توفر واجهات سهلة الاستخدام وتتيح تعديلات متقدمة دون كتابة كود برمجي. ومن أشهر هذه الإضافات:

a. LoginPress

إضافة قوية ومجانية، تتيح للمستخدمين تعديل كل تفاصيل صفحة تسجيل الدخول تقريبًا، بما في ذلك:

  • تغيير الخلفية (صورة أو لون)

  • تعديل لون الأزرار والخطوط

  • تعديل شعار الصفحة

  • تخصيص الرسائل والنصوص

  • إخفاء روابط معينة أو تعديل سلوك الصفحة

b. Theme My Login

توفر هذه الإضافة إمكانية عرض صفحة تسجيل الدخول ضمن تصميم القالب الحالي، دون الحاجة إلى الانتقال إلى صفحة wp-login.php. وتشمل ميزاتها:

  • دعم تسجيل الدخول من الواجهة الأمامية (Front-end)

  • تخصيص النماذج بسهولة

  • دعم عمليات التسجيل واستعادة كلمة المرور

c. Custom Login Page Customizer

إضافة مبنية على أداة التخصيص (Customizer) المدمجة في ووردبريس، ما يعني أنك تستطيع تعديل شكل صفحة تسجيل الدخول ومشاهدة التغييرات في الوقت الفعلي.

اسم الإضافة الميزات الرئيسية مدى التخصيص
LoginPress تخصيص كامل للصفحة، دعم للغة العربية، واجهة سهلة الاستخدام عالي
Theme My Login تسجيل من الواجهة الأمامية، دعم تعدد الأدوار متوسط
Custom Login Customizer تخصيص مباشر عبر Customizer، خفيف وسريع متوسط إلى عالي

2. التخصيص عبر كود PHP في ملف functions.php

لمن لديهم خبرة بسيطة بالكود، يمكن تخصيص الصفحة عبر إضافة بعض الأسطر البرمجية إلى ملف functions.php داخل القالب المستخدم. وفيما يلي بعض الأمثلة العملية:

تغيير شعار ووردبريس الافتراضي

php
function custom_login_logo() { echo ' '; } add_action('login_head', 'custom_login_logo');

تغيير رابط الشعار إلى الصفحة الرئيسية بدلًا من موقع ووردبريس

php
function custom_login_logo_url() { return home_url(); } add_filter('login_headerurl', 'custom_login_logo_url');

تعديل نص التلميح Hover على الشعار

php
function custom_login_logo_url_title() { return 'مرحبًا بك في موقعنا'; } add_filter('login_headertitle', 'custom_login_logo_url_title');

تخصيص CSS إضافي

php
function custom_login_stylesheet() { wp_enqueue_style('custom-login', get_stylesheet_directory_uri() . '/login-style.css'); } add_action('login_enqueue_scripts', 'custom_login_stylesheet');

3. التخصيص باستخدام CSS مخصص

يمكنك إنشاء ملف CSS مخصص لتصميم صفحة تسجيل الدخول حسب رغبتك. ما عليك سوى إضافته إلى قالب الموقع واستدعاؤه كما في المثال أعلاه. ومن بعض الأكواد المفيدة:

css
body.login { background-color: #f1f1f1; } .login form { background: #ffffff; box-shadow: 0px 0px 10px #ccc; border-radius: 10px; } .login label { color: #333333; } .login #backtoblog, .login #nav { display: none; }

خطوات تنفيذ تخصيص شامل لصفحة تسجيل الدخول

  1. اختيار الطريقة المناسبة: حدد ما إذا كنت تفضل الإضافات أو التخصيص عبر الكود.

  2. تحضير الملفات: إذا كنت ستستخدم كودًا، أنشئ مجلدًا للصور وملفات CSS داخل القالب.

  3. تجريب التغييرات محليًا أو على نسخة تجريبية: لتفادي تعطيل الموقع الأساسي.

  4. اختبار التوافق: تأكد من أن التخصيص يعمل على مختلف الأجهزة والمتصفحات.

  5. تحسين الأداء: تجنب تحميل صور عالية الجودة تؤثر على سرعة الصفحة.

  6. التحقق من الأمان: أزل أي روابط قد يستغلها المتسللون، وفعّل الحماية ضد محاولات تسجيل الدخول العشوائية.


توصيات أمان عند تخصيص صفحة تسجيل الدخول

  • تغيير عنوان صفحة الدخول: باستخدام إضافات مثل WPS Hide Login لمنع الوصول إلى wp-login.php.

  • تحديد عدد المحاولات الفاشلة: للحد من هجمات القوة العمياء (Brute Force).

  • تفعيل المصادقة الثنائية (2FA): لطبقة حماية إضافية.

  • استخدام HTTPS: لتأمين عملية نقل البيانات بين المستخدم والخادم.


تجربة المستخدم والهوية البصرية

عند تخصيص صفحة تسجيل الدخول، من الأفضل الحفاظ على التناسق مع التصميم العام للموقع. فصفحة تسجيل غير منسقة أو تتضمن ألوانًا مختلفة تمامًا عن باقي صفحات الموقع قد تخلق شعورًا بالشك لدى المستخدمين، خصوصًا إن كانت الصفحة تتطلب إدخال بيانات حساسة. يمكن اعتماد النقاط التالية لضمان تجربة متكاملة:

  • استخدام نفس الخطوط والألوان المستخدمة في القالب.

  • تضمين شعار واضح ودقة عالية.

  • إظهار رسالة ترحيبية بسيطة أو إرشادية.

  • تجنب العناصر المزعجة أو المتحركة المبالغ فيها.


استخدام أدوات التصميم المرئي لتخصيص النموذج

بعض الإضافات تدعم التصميم المرئي (Visual Builder)، مما يسمح للمستخدم بسحب وإفلات العناصر (Drag & Drop). يمكن بهذه الأدوات تخصيص ليس فقط المظهر بل أيضًا هيكل النموذج:

  • إضافة حقول مخصصة: مثل رقم الهاتف أو الدولة.

  • إخفاء الحقول الافتراضية: التي قد لا تكون ضرورية.

  • تغيير ترتيب الحقول: لتتناسب مع طبيعة مستخدمي الموقع.


أمثلة على حالات الاستخدام

  • مواقع العضويات: حيث يحتاج المستخدم إلى تسجيل مستمر، ويُفضل أن تكون واجهة تسجيل جذابة وسريعة.

  • المواقع التعليمية: مثل منصات التعلم الإلكتروني التي تطلب بيانات تسجيل مفصلة.

  • مواقع المتاجر الإلكترونية: لتعزيز الثقة من خلال صفحة تسجيل تحمل هوية بصرية موحدة.


التحديث والصيانة

بعد تخصيص صفحة تسجيل الدخول، من المهم اختبار التعديلات بعد كل تحديث لووردبريس أو القالب أو الإضافات، حيث أن بعض التحديثات قد تؤدي إلى تعطيل الأكواد أو إزالتها. يُفضل أيضًا حفظ نسخة احتياطية من الأكواد المخصصة.


الخاتمة

تخصيص صفحة تسجيل الدخول في ووردبريس خطوة استراتيجية تؤثر إيجابًا في تجربة المستخدم، وتمنح الموقع مظهرًا احترافيًا متكاملًا. سواء تم ذلك عبر إضافات جاهزة أو من خلال كتابة أكواد مخصصة، تبقى النتيجة واحدة: واجهة تتماشى مع هوية الموقع وتلبي حاجات مستخدميه. ويظل الأهم في هذه العملية هو الجمع بين التصميم الجذاب والوظيفة الفعّالة والأمان العالي.

المراجع: